Output 80b5a150953ae7b23b54bf4e62c5b365234aed529da44b0a905684ef28973b9d:0
- value
- 13023362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e2577401c4c3662daf836d859aa6831afe7b526 OP_EQUAL
- address
- 3DC1wtJXJZw7LyzgDqgKuhPGXno9FncwE5
- transaction
- 80b5a150953ae7b23b54bf4e62c5b365234aed529da44b0a905684ef28973b9d
- spent
- true